De Bortoli Melba Vineyard Cabernet Sauvignon 2018


Only made in exceptional years, the Melba is named after Dame Nelly (who gave her name to the peach).

Forget about any presence of peach - or any stonefruit for that matter - here, it's a classically structured Cabernet: black fruit - think plum, damson, hints of blackcurrant - with savoury edges.

Really it's the grippy tannins that win here, coating the palate and giving both length, breadth and depth. As much as you might want to get your hands on Nellie now, patience is a virtue. One for the long haul! 94
